Bachmann M200 Series Technical Notes

The Evolution of M200 Series Architecture

The Bachmann M200 platform was introduced as a successor to earlier single-board controller architectures, consolidating CPU, I/O, and communication functions into a standardized backplane bus system. Early revisions used a proprietary parallel backplane with fixed slot addressing; later hardware generations introduced a high-speed serial backplane (SBus) that increased inter-module bandwidth and reduced cycle time jitter. The CNT204 counter module has been produced across multiple hardware revisions, with firmware updates addressing encoder interface compatibility (TTL, HTL, RS422 differential) and extended counting range (32-bit to 48-bit accumulator). Compatibility between M200 CPU generations (MPC240, MPC265) and I/O modules requires firmware version alignment — a critical consideration for spare part procurement in mixed-revision installations. The platform entered its mature/maintenance phase; Bachmann has shifted primary development resources to the M1 series, making long-term spare part availability for M200 modules a strategic concern for plant operators.

M200 Series Full Catalog & Functionalities (SKU List)

Counter & Encoder Modules

  • CNT204: 4-channel high-speed counter module; TTL/HTL/RS422 encoder input; 32-bit accumulator; frequency measurement up to 1 MHz.
  • CNT202: 2-channel counter/encoder interface; supports SSI absolute encoders; 24-bit resolution.

Digital I/O Modules

  • DIO232: 32-channel digital input module; 24 VDC; IEC 61131-2 Type 1/3 compatible.
  • DIO248: 48-channel mixed digital I/O; configurable input/output ratio per channel group.
  • DIO280: 80-channel high-density digital I/O; backplane bus optimized for large-scale discrete control.
  • DIO216: 16-channel digital output module; 24 VDC sourcing; 0.5 A per channel; short-circuit protected.

Analog I/O Modules

  • AIO288: 8-channel analog input / 8-channel analog output; ±10 V / 0–20 mA; 16-bit resolution.
  • AIO120: 20-channel analog input; 4–20 mA / 0–10 V; 12-bit resolution; field-wiring terminal block.
  • AIC212: 12-channel analog current input; 4–20 mA; HART pass-through capable on select firmware.
  • AIC208: 8-channel analog current output; 4–20 mA; 16-bit DAC; loop-powered field devices.

Temperature & Specialty Measurement

  • TMP200: 8-channel thermocouple input module; supports J, K, T, E, N, R, S, B types; cold-junction compensation onboard.
  • TMP204: 4-channel RTD input module; PT100/PT1000; 3-wire and 4-wire connection; 0.1 °C resolution.

Communication & Gateway Modules

  • GMP232: PROFIBUS-DP slave interface module; up to 12 Mbit/s; supports GSD file configuration.
  • GMP212: PROFIBUS-DP master module; manages up to 125 slave nodes; diagnostic buffer onboard.
  • RS204: 4-port serial communication module; RS232/RS485 configurable per port; Modbus RTU master/slave.
  • EXC208: 8-slot I/O expansion chassis interface; extends backplane to remote rack; fiber-optic isolation option.
  • ISI222: Industrial serial interface module; supports DNP3 and IEC 60870-5-101 protocols.
  • NT255: Network time synchronization module; GPS/IRIG-B input; distributes time reference across M200 backplane.

CPU & Controller Modules

  • MPC240: Main CPU module; 400 MHz processor; 64 MB RAM; dual Ethernet; IEC 61131-3 runtime; supports SIL 2 applications with certified firmware.
  • MPC265: Enhanced CPU module; 800 MHz processor; 128 MB RAM; USB configuration port; extended diagnostic logging.
